diff --git a/argocd/apps/kube-prometheus/kube-prometheus.yaml b/argocd/apps/kube-prometheus/kube-prometheus.yaml index 79a503e..36a5fe6 100644 --- a/argocd/apps/kube-prometheus/kube-prometheus.yaml +++ b/argocd/apps/kube-prometheus/kube-prometheus.yaml @@ -1,47 +1,53 @@ -#apiVersion: argoproj.io/v1alpha1 -#kind: Application -#metadata: -# name: monitoring -# finalizers: -# - resources-finalizer.argocd.argoproj.io -#spec: -# project: default -# source: -# repoURL: 'https://prometheus-community.github.io/helm-charts' -# chart: prometheus -# targetRevision: 27.*.* -# helm: -# parameters: -# - name: ingress.enabled -# value: "true" -# - name: ingress.className -# value: "traefik" -# - name: ingress.hosts[0] -# value: "monitoring.innovation-hub-niedersachsen.de" -# - name: ingress.annotations.kubernetes\.io\/ingress\.class -# value: traefik -# - name: ingress.tls[0].secretName -# value: "monitoring-tls" -# - name: ingress.annotations.traefik\.ingress\.kubernetes\.io\/router\.entrypoints -# value: websecure -# - name: ingress.annotations.kubernetes\.io\/ingress\.class -# value: traefik -# - name: ingress.annotations.traefik\.ingress\.kubernetes\.io\/router\.tls -# value: 'true' -# forceString: true -# - name: ingress.tls[0].hosts[0] -# value: "monitoring.innovation-hub-niedersachsen.de" -# - name: ingress.annotations.cert-manager\.io\/cluster-issuer -# value: lets-encrypt -# destination: -# server: 'https://kubernetes.default.svc' -# namespace: monitoring -# syncPolicy: -# managedNamespaceMetadata: -# labels: -# pod-security.kubernetes.io/enforce: "privileged" -# automated: -# selfHeal: true -# prune: true -# syncOptions: -# - CreateNamespace=true +apiVersion: argoproj.io/v1alpha1 +kind: Application +metadata: + name: kube-prometheus-stack + finalizers: + - resources-finalizer.argocd.argoproj.io +spec: + project: default + source: + repoURL: 'https://prometheus-community.github.io/helm-charts' + chart: kube-prometheus-stack + targetRevision: 72.*.* + helm: + parameters: + - name: grafana.adminPasswort + value: "InnoHubNI_2025!" + -name: grafana.service.type: + value: "ClusterIP" + - name: prometheus.prometheusSpec.serviceMonitorSelectorNilUsesHelmValues + value: "false" + - name: ingress.enabled + value: "true" + - name: ingress.className + value: "traefik" + - name: ingress.hosts[0] + value: "monitoring.innovation-hub-niedersachsen.de" + - name: ingress.annotations.kubernetes\.io\/ingress\.class + value: traefik + - name: ingress.tls[0].secretName + value: "monitoring-tls" + - name: ingress.annotations.traefik\.ingress\.kubernetes\.io\/router\.entrypoints + value: websecure + - name: ingress.annotations.kubernetes\.io\/ingress\.class + value: traefik + - name: ingress.annotations.traefik\.ingress\.kubernetes\.io\/router\.tls + value: 'true' + forceString: true + - name: ingress.tls[0].hosts[0] + value: "monitoring.innovation-hub-niedersachsen.de" + - name: ingress.annotations.cert-manager\.io\/cluster-issuer + value: lets-encrypt + destination: + server: 'https://kubernetes.default.svc' + namespace: monitoring + syncPolicy: + managedNamespaceMetadata: + labels: + pod-security.kubernetes.io/enforce: "privileged" + automated: + selfHeal: true + prune: true + syncOptions: + - CreateNamespace=true